with Langfuse and Speechace?
Emit new event when user feedback (score) is submitted on a trace in Langfuse. See the documentation
Emit new event when a new trace is recorded in Langfuse. See the documentation
Attach user feedback to an existing trace in Langfuse. See the documentation
Scores a scripted recording based on fluency and pronunciation. See the documentation
Transcribes and scores a provided speech recording. See the documentation
import { axios } from "@pipedream/platform"
export default defineComponent({
props: {
langfuse: {
type: "app",
app: "langfuse",
}
},
async run({steps, $}) {
return await axios($, {
url: `https://${this.langfuse.$auth.region}.langfuse.com/api/public/observations`,
auth: {
username: `${this.langfuse.$auth.public_key}`,
password: `${this.langfuse.$auth.secret_key}`,
},
})
},
})
The Speechace API offers capabilities for detailed speech analysis, particularly useful for language learning applications. With this API, you can assess users' pronunciation and fluency in English by analyzing audio inputs. In Pipedream, you can leverage this API to craft workflows that trigger on various events, process audio data, and perform actions based on the analysis—such as storing results, providing feedback, or integrating with other services for enhanced functionality.
import { axios } from "@pipedream/platform"
export default defineComponent({
props: {
speechace: {
type: "app",
app: "speechace",
}
},
async run({steps, $}) {
return await axios($, {
method: "post",
url: `https://api.speechace.co/api/validating/text/v9/json`,
params: {
key: `${this.speechace.$auth.product_key}`,
dialect: `en-us`,
text: `Welcome to the world of workflow automation.`,
},
})
},
})